Hurricane Erin became a catastrophic Category 5 storm before noon on Saturday, Aug. 16, according to the National Hurricane Center. A Category 5 hurricane is one with winds of 157 mph or higher. Hurricane Erin's maximum sustained winds are 160 mph.
Erin is setting records as it became the third hurricane to have the most significant pressure drop in history. Maximum sustained winds increased 85 mph in just 24 hours!
